The development and fabrication of microfabricated propulsion components at the Jet Propulsion Laboratory is reviewed. These include a vaporizing liquid micro-thruster, which vaporizes propellant to produce thrust. Thrust performances of 32 (mu) N for an input power of 0.8 W were measured. Miniature solenoid and latch valves are being developed by Moog, Inc. in collaboration with JPL.
